I have been using a sample of this product for about 2 weeks or so and OMG I'm in freaking LOVE!!!  Now, this product is not for my hair type... at all.  I received it because I indicated I have a bit of a wave to my hair which is true.  It is definitely for someone with much more coarse or curly hair than mine for sure.  It is extremely thick almost like a white paste that does not melt and soften as you rub it in your palms although you can't see it once it is on the hair.  It is also somewhere in between tacky and sticky feeling.  I had to kind of place it into my hair rather than smooth it through like you might normally do with a "cream" product.  It left my extremely long and baby fine hair feeling the way a pliable gel might which for someone with serious curl would hold each curl that you wound into shape in place perfectly without making it look crisp or wet and crunchy, and even though it isn't what I really need for my hair type I was still able to curl or straighten my hair without issue.  It is designed to be worked into the hair in sections from root to tip (which I didn't really do because I don't have enough hair to bother), is made with 100% shea butter, aloe vera, and coconut oil, and is supposed to provide intense moisture and strength for soft manageable curls while adding shine and healing dry damaged hair.  Can I just tell you how FANTASTIC this stuff smells?!?  It is like coconut mixed with fruit (but it's not pineapple which makes it a refreshingly new twist on a fruity coconut scent) and the scent lasts and lasts.  It has been FOREVER since the last time I've found a product that had fragrance that actually sticks with you and every time the freezing cold bitter wind would whip I'd get a nose full of this most incredible scent EVER.  I'd even catch myself holding my hair under my nose and sniffing while I was concentrating on work during the day (which I don't recommend doing in public unless you are completely ok with strange looks from people).  It is SOOOOOOO GOOOOOOOOOD!  I'd really like to know what my friends with natural hair think of it.  The brand also offers Twist & Lock Gel, Activator Cream, Hair Lotion, Shine & Hold Mist, Co-Wash, and a Deep Treatment Masque.  I'm prepared to beg them to create a mousse so I can use these products on a regular basis the smell is that good.  I should also mention they have no mineral oil, sulfates, parabens, soilicone, phthalates, gluten, paraffin, propylene, PABA, or DEA.

I started my day with a little Flowerbomb by Viktor & Rolf.  


It was pre-shower, but I just needed a little indulgence to start my morning right.  It is of course a floral which you know I am generally not a fan of, but this is a floral I don't mind.  There is just enough Ballerina Freesia to lighten the mood and soften the Sambac Jasmine and Centifolia Rose.  The Cattleya Orchid and Patchouli mix to round out what normally might be rough floral edges.  Even though it is described as an Oriental, Gourmand, Floral I honestly don't get the Oriental part.  It just doesn't have the bite or burn or bitterness of a typical Oriental fragrance.

Speaking of Oriental Florals... can we just talk about this little doozy for a second?  I'm referring to Gucci Guilty.  


We're talking Mandarin, Pink Pepper (there is that bite), Peach, Lilac, Geranium, Amber, and Patchouli.  This fragrance is described as daring, rich, and sexy.  I'm sure from the notes you can see why.  Which leads me to my next mention which is Gucci Guilty for Men.


While similar to it's sister fragrance in that it has Mandarin and Pink Pepper, the Lemon Citrus, Fresh Lavender, and Crushed Green Leaves give it the masculine distinction we expect from Gucci.  This scent is described as youthful, charismatic, and fearless and we can all conjure up what that should look like in our heads can't we?  Hubba!  Hubba!
